Understanding What Bail Really Means

Bail isn't an incentive or a verdict, it's a conditional release. Your liked one has assured to show up in court and comply with particular policies in exchange for continuing to be in the neighborhood as opposed to waiting in custody. Those problems vary by territory and judge, yet they frequently include check-ins with pretrial services, travel constraints, medicine testing, time limits, and no call orders. Sometimes an ankle display goes into the photo. The specifics issue, because also a technological infraction can activate a remand to jail.

If your liked one made use of Bail Bonds to protect launch, include another layer. A bail bond is an agreement. The bond agent posts bail with the court, usually for a nonrefundable cost that's a portion of the complete bail quantity, and your enjoyed one accepts follow terms established by both the court and the bail bondsman. Miss a hearing or vanish, and the bond representative can seek repayment, include recovery representatives, and come contacting anybody who co-signed.

There's a cultural misconception that bail is an one-time obstacle. Actually, it's a period that can recently, months, or, in rare complicated instances, more than a year. Deal with the entire timeline as a project with landmarks, dangers, and clear roles for everybody involved.

Get the Conditions in Writing and Make Them Unmissable

You can't help if you don't recognize the policies. Begin by collecting every piece of documentation from the court and, if made use of, the bond business. Look for these details: specific hearing days, addresses for every hearing (courts might make use of numerous buildings), pretrial reporting guidelines, get in touch with numbers for clerks and pretrial solutions, and any type of no-contact or stay-away orders with exact distances. If there's an ankle joint display, confirm that monitors it, just how it's billed, and just how alerts work.

Do not depend on memory or a solitary message string. Develop redundancy. I have actually seen a lot of cases where a liked one urged a hearing was "next Friday," just to uncover it shifted to Thursday or was in a various court house. Mistakes take place at every level, consisting of notice errors. Paper back-ups and digital schedules with alerts established 2 days, eventually, and two hours beforehand catch the majority of these problems.

Numbers matter. Track the case number, the court's name, and the area or department. Staffs will frequently request those first, and having them ready puncture confusion and holds.

Money and Bail: Know the Responsibilities and the Options

Bail is expensive, also when a bond decreases the upfront price. If your loved one made use of a bond, somebody likely paid a percentage charge that is nonrefundable, frequently 8 to 15 percent relying on state regulation and the bond firm's policy. There might be service charges for electronic tracking, check-ins, or payment plans. Understand who authorized the bond and who is on the hook if points go wrong.

If repayments schedule regular or monthly, treat them as a concern bill. Late costs and calls from the bondsman add tension, and unsettled commitments can threaten launch. If the bond firm requires updated contact info or check-ins, fulfill those demands specifically. People often bristle at the oversight, however it's part of the deal.

Not every situation needs or utilizes Bail Bonds. In some territories, courts favor recognizance launches or supervised release instead of cash bond. Ask the legal representative if choices exist, particularly if funds are limited. In a handful of instances I've seen, a court converted a cash bail to pretrial supervision after a few months of great compliance and documented difficulty. That type of modification seldom occurs without a clean record of check-ins and appearances.

When You're the Co-signer: Special Obligations and Tough Decisions

Co-signers, likewise called indemnitors, carry lawful obligation on bond contracts. If you authorized, you agreed to make sure appearances and to inform the bond business of any type of issues. This isn't symbolic. If your loved one vanishes, you may deal with economic effects and hostile collection efforts.

Set expectations initially. Explain that proceeded assistance relies on compliance. If you see early indicators of difficulty, like skipped check-ins or vanishing for nights without explanation, address it quickly. In my experience, co-signers who act early, in some cases by arranging a frank three-way conversation with the bondsman, prevent worse results. An unpleasant action, like revoking the bond, may be safer than an installing economic obligation and potential legal exposure. It is not betrayal to protect your home and finances. It is a truthful reaction to an unsafe or unsustainable situation.

The Day Bail Ends: What's Next

If the case solves without safekeeping, anticipate supervision problems like probation or social work. Transfer your good routines right into the following phase. Maintain the schedule, proceed documentation, and preserve communication with the managing police officer. If the court orders jail time, focus on prep work: safe items, organize take care of dependents, and compile a health and drugs checklist. Few points reduce the strain of reporting to wardship like an efficient plan that shields home, work, and family.

If the bond is vindicated at case resolution, confirm with the bond firm in creating. Make certain any security, such as a lorry title or residential or commercial property act, is released and documented. Loose ends left untied can haunt your credit scores and your peace of mind.
